Abstract
Certain pins of an XFP connector are re-purposed to enable the connector to receive, for example, four 11.88 Gb/s serial data streams (for a receiver), or output four 11.88 Gb/s serial data streams (for a transmitter). The four data streams are wavelength division multiplexed inside the XFP module for transmission over a single optical fiber, providing a total interface capacity of 47.52 Gb/s. An XFP receiver module is defined to convert the WDM signal back to four 11.88 Gb/s serial data streams.
